苏州蓝翼电脑科技有限公司
.net程序员笔试题1. int[][] myArray3=new int[3][]{new int[3]{5,6,2},new int[5]{6,9,7,8,3},new int[2]{3,2}}; myArray3[2][2]的值是()。
  1. 9
  2. 2
  3. 6
  4. 越界
2. 关于ASP.NET中的代码隐藏文件的描述正确的是()
  1. Web窗体页的程序的逻辑由代码组成,这些代码的创建用于与窗体交互。编程逻辑唯一与用户界面不同的文件中。该文件称作为“代码隐藏”文件,如果用C#创建。Asmx.cs该文件
  2. 项目中所有Web窗体页的代码隐藏文件都被编译成.EXE文件
  3. 项目中所有的Web窗体页的代码隐藏文件都被编译成项目动态链接库(.dll)文件
  4. 以上都不正确
3. 您要创建ASP.NET应用程序用于运行AllWin公司内部的Web站点,这个应用程序包含了50个页面。您想要配置这个应用程序以便当发生一个HTTP代码错误时它可以显示一个自定义的错误页面给用户。您想要花最小的代价完成这些目标,您应该怎么做?(多选)
   1. 在这个应用程序的Global.asax文件中创建一个Application_Error过程去处理ASP.NET代码错误。
   2. 在这个应用程序的Web.config文件中创建一个applicationError节去处理ASP.NET代码错误。
   3. 在这个应用程序的Global.asax文件中创建一个CustomErrors事件去处理HTTP错误。
   4. 在这个应用程序的Web.config文件中创建一个CustomErrors节去处理HTTP错误。
4. 三种常用的字符串判空串方法:哪种方法最快?
   1: bool isEmpty = (str.Length == 0); 
   2: bool isEmpty = (str == String.Empty); 
   3: bool isEmpty = (str == "");
5. 下列ASP.NET语句哪个正确地创建了一个与SQL Server 2000数据库的连接。
1)SqlConnection con1 = new Connection(“Data Source = localhost; Integrated Security = SSPI; Initial Catalog = myDB”);
2)SqlConnection con1 = new SqlConnection(“Data Source = localhost; Integrated Security = SSPI; Initial Catalog = myDB”);
3)SqlConnection con1 = new SqlConnection(Data Source = localhost; Integrated Security = SSPI; Initial Catalog = myDB);
4)SqlConnection con1 = new OleDbConnection(“Data Source = localhost; Integrated Security = SSPI; Initial Catalog = myDB”);
6. 某一密码仅使用A、L、H、N、P共5个字母,密码中的单词从左向右排列,密码单词必须遵循如下规则:
(1) 密码单词的最小长度是两个字母,可以相同,也可以不同
(2) A不可能是单词的第一个字母
(3) 如果L出现,则出现次数不止一次
(4) H不能使最后一个也不能是倒数第二个字母
(5) A出现,则N就一定出现
(6) P如果是最后一个字母,则L一定出现
问题一:下列哪一个字母可以放在LP中的P后面,形成一个3个字母的密码单词?
A) A   B)L   C) H  D) N
 
问题二:如果能得到的字母是A、L、H,那么能够形成的两个字母长的密码单词的总数是多少?
A)1个  B)3个  C)6个  D)9个 问题三:下列哪一个是单词密码?
A) ALLN   B) LPHL   C) HLLP   D)NHAP